Overview
The AD9222ABCPZ-50 is an octal, 12-bit analog-to-digital converter (ADC) produced by Analog Devices Inc. This device is designed for low cost, low power, small size, and ease of use, making it ideal for various high-performance applications. It operates at a conversion rate of up to 50 MSPS and features an on-chip sample-and-hold circuit. The ADC requires a single 1.8 V power supply and supports LVPECL-, CMOS-, and LVDS-compatible sample rate clocks. It is optimized for outstanding dynamic performance and low power consumption, particularly in applications where a small package size is critical.

Key Features
- Small Footprint: Eight ADCs are contained in a small, space-saving 64-lead LFCSP_VQ package, making it ideal for applications where size is critical.
- Low Power Consumption: The device operates at a low power of 114 mW/channel at 50 MSPS, enhancing energy efficiency in high-performance systems.
- Ease of Use: A data clock output (DCO) is provided, operating at frequencies up to 390 MHz and supporting double data rate (DDR) operation. This simplifies data capture and system integration.
- User Flexibility: The SPI control interface offers a wide range of flexible features to meet specific system requirements, allowing for customized configurations.
- Pin-Compatible Family: The AD9222 is part of a pin-compatible family that includes the AD9212 (10-bit) and AD9252 (14-bit), facilitating design flexibility and scalability.
Applications
The AD9222ABCPZ-50 is suitable for a variety of high-performance applications, including:
- Medical Imaging: Ultrasound, MRI, and other medical imaging technologies benefit from the high resolution and low power consumption of this ADC.
- Industrial Automation: High-speed data acquisition in industrial control systems and automation equipment can utilize the AD9222 for precise and reliable data conversion.
- Test and Measurement Equipment: The device is well-suited for use in oscilloscopes, signal analyzers, and other test equipment due to its high dynamic performance and low noise characteristics.
- Communications Systems: The AD9222 can be used in wireless communication systems, radar systems, and other applications requiring high-speed analog-to-digital conversion.
